Supervalu to 'Win With Fresh Produce'

MINNEAPOLIS — Supervalu will be rolling out a new local produce program to its banner stores beginning this summer, Craig Herkert, chief executive officer, said in remarks at the retailer's annual meeting here Thursday.

The porogram, facilitated by Supervalu's W. Newell specialty produce organization, will introduce special labels and signs noting the source of its products, with signs reading "Just arrived" to note freshest items and "Locally Harvested" to highlight items from nearby sources.

The program, dubbed "Win with Fresh Produce," is among the priorities for Supervalu in fiscal 2011, Herkert said.

"This program brings another level of hyper-local marketing into our stores, where the shopper knows that we support the local economy by purchasing locally, it sends a positive message about our stores," he said.

Supervalu shareholders at the meeting Thursday voted to approve a slate of 10 board members; to ratify the appointment of KPMG as auditor; and in favor of a proposal allowing them to vote at every third Supervalu annual meeting on the compensation policies and procedures, beginning in 2011.
